Comparing Cloud-based vs. On-premise Drone Software Solutions

Drone technology has revolutionized industries such as agriculture, construction, and surveillance. As the use of drones expands, selecting the right software solution becomes crucial. Two primary options are cloud-based and on-premise drone software. Understanding their differences helps organizations make informed decisions.

What is Cloud-Based Drone Software?

Cloud-based drone software operates on remote servers accessed via the internet. Users can manage, analyze, and store drone data without maintaining physical servers. This approach offers flexibility and ease of access from anywhere with an internet connection.

What is On-Premise Drone Software?

On-premise drone software is installed locally on a company’s own servers or computers. It provides complete control over data security and system customization. Organizations with strict data policies often prefer this option.

Key Differences Between the Two Solutions

  • Accessibility: Cloud-based solutions offer remote access, while on-premise requires physical access to local servers.
  • Cost: Cloud solutions typically involve subscription fees; on-premise requires significant upfront investment in hardware and maintenance.
  • Security: On-premise provides greater control over sensitive data, whereas cloud providers implement robust security measures but involve third-party trust.
  • Scalability: Cloud systems can scale easily with demand, whereas on-premise may require hardware upgrades.
  • Maintenance: Cloud providers handle updates and maintenance; on-premise requires in-house IT support.

Pros and Cons

Cloud-Based Solutions

Pros: Easy to access, scalable, lower upfront costs, automatic updates.

Cons: Ongoing subscription costs, data security concerns, dependent on internet connectivity.

On-Premise Solutions

Pros: Greater control over data, customizable, suitable for sensitive operations.

Cons: Higher initial investment, requires dedicated IT support, less flexible scaling.

Choosing the Right Solution

Organizations should evaluate their specific needs, budget, and security requirements. For those prioritizing flexibility and lower initial costs, cloud-based solutions are ideal. Conversely, entities handling sensitive data or requiring extensive customization might prefer on-premise systems.

Conclusion

Both cloud-based and on-premise drone software solutions have unique advantages and challenges. Careful assessment of organizational needs will ensure the selection of the most effective system to support drone operations and data management.